Not an archery kill, but my 06 NY rifle kill taken this morning at APAJaws place near Oneonta, NY. I thought he had both sides, he was about 200 yards when I shot. He is still a great buck though and unusual for sure. He didn't break the other side off, it simply has no pedicle on that side so nothing grew there. APAJaws thinks he is a small 3.5 year old but tomorrow we will get his jaw open and look at the teeth. Anyhow it's probably good to get him out of there before we have a lot of unicorns running around. [8D]

I still have a NY late season archery buck tag, a NY doe tag, and a PA doe tag. I hope to fill one more, but if not........it still has been a great year.
